Key Responsibilities:
- FHIR Data Analysis: Analyze and integrate healthcare data using FHIR (Fast Healthcare Interoperability Resources) data systems, with a focus on developing and implementing FHIR-based solutions.
- HEDIS Measure Development: reputed company and implement HEDIS (Healthcare Effectiveness Data and Information Set) measures using reputed company (Clinical Quality Language) to evaluate the performance of health plans and medical providers.
- Data Integration: Integrate data from various sources, including EHR systems, claims data, and other healthcare data sources, to drive business insights and improve patient outcomes.
- Data Quality and Validation: Ensure data quality and validation, including data cleaning, data transformation, and data mapping.
- Reporting and Visualization: reputed company reports and visualizations to communicate insights and findings to stakeholders, including healthcare providers, payers, and patients.
- Collaboration and Communication: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including healthcare providers, payers, and technology vendors, to design and implement data-driven solutions.
